Flex3界面布局教程:一路风尘制作
需积分: 13 19 浏览量
更新于2024-10-30
收藏 313KB PDF 举报
Flex3界面布局中文教程——一路风尘制作,深入解析了Flex3中用于构建用户界面的各种布局容器,旨在帮助开发者更好地理解和应用这些布局以实现美观且功能丰富的GUI设计。本教程覆盖了多个关键布局容器,包括Canvas、ControlBar、ApplicationControlBar、DividedBox、Form、Grid、Panel、TitleWindow以及TitleLayout。
Canvas布局容器是Flex3中的基础容器之一,它允许开发者自定义组件的位置。Canvas提供了两种布局模式:Absolute模式和constraint-based模式。在Absolute模式下,每个组件的位置需要通过设置x和y坐标来精确指定,坐标系统以Canvas的左上角为原点。而constraint-based模式则依赖于side, baseline或center anchors来确定组件位置,更便于响应式布局。
ControlBarlayout容器,如ApplicationControlBar,通常用于放置应用的控制元素,如按钮和菜单,帮助用户进行交互。DividedBox布局(包括HDividedBox和VDividedBox)则提供了分割区域,允许用户调整各部分大小,常用于创建可调整的面板布局。
Form布局专门用于组织和显示数据输入表单,它能够自动对齐和排列输入字段,使得用户填写信息更加方便。Grid布局则按照行列结构排列组件,适合展示列表数据或创建表格形式的界面。
Panel容器是一种带有标题的可选项卡式布局,常用于封装一组相关的组件。TitleWindow容器类似于Panel,但具有弹出窗口的特性,通常用于创建模态对话框。
Titlelayout容器,尽管在文档中提及,但没有详细展开,可能是用于自定义标题布局的容器,允许开发者个性化标题的展示方式。
Flex3的布局容器提供了强大的界面设计能力,开发者可以根据需求选择合适的布局策略,创建出适应性强、用户体验优秀的应用程序。通过深入学习这些布局容器的特性和用法,可以提升Flex3应用的界面设计水平,实现更加灵活多变的界面效果。在实际开发中,结合ActionScript的动态操作,可以进一步增强界面的交互性和功能性。
2009-12-04 上传
2017-09-08 上传
2023-01-03 上传
104 浏览量
2022-09-23 上传
2021-07-25 上传
2024-06-15 上传
2022-09-20 上传
linuxmax
- 粉丝: 0
- 资源: 19
最新资源
- SSM动力电池数据管理系统源码及数据库详解
- R语言桑基图绘制与SCI图输入文件代码分析
- Linux下Sakagari Hurricane翻译工作:cpktools的使用教程
- prettybench: 让 Go 基准测试结果更易读
- Python官方文档查询库,提升开发效率与时间节约
- 基于Django的Python就业系统毕设源码
- 高并发下的SpringBoot与Nginx+Redis会话共享解决方案
- 构建问答游戏:Node.js与Express.js实战教程
- MATLAB在旅行商问题中的应用与优化方法研究
- OMAPL138 DSP平台UPP接口编程实践
- 杰克逊维尔非营利地基工程的VMS项目介绍
- 宠物猫企业网站模板PHP源码下载
- 52简易计算器源码解析与下载指南
- 探索Node.js v6.2.1 - 事件驱动的高性能Web服务器环境
- 找回WinSCP密码的神器:winscppasswd工具介绍
- xctools:解析Xcode命令行工具输出的Ruby库